The recipe calls for medium (300-350) for about 1-1/2 hours. I believe this one was closer to 2 hrs as I was looking for a temp of 160 with my Weber remote thermometer. Turned out great and it was great for a crowd. I even made his Tennessee BBQ sauce that was a perfect sauce for this loin.
